A living room is often the main gathering space in a home, and it's important to create a welcoming and comfortable atmosphere. One way to achieve this is through a well-executed living room drawing. By carefully planning and sketching out the details of your living room, you can create a space that reflects your personal style and meets your needs. Let's take a look at the top 10 tips for drawing a living room with furniture.Living Room Drawing
The furniture you choose for your living room can make a big impact on the overall look and feel of the space. When drawing out your living room design, it's important to consider the furniture placement and how it will affect the flow of the room. Use bold lines to represent the furniture in your drawing and make sure to highlight any key pieces that will be the focal point of the room.Living Room Furniture Drawing
A sketch is a great way to visualize your living room design before committing to it. Use a pencil and paper to sketch out your ideas, including any furniture, decor, and layout options. This will help you get a better idea of how the final product will look and allow you to make any necessary changes before moving on to the next step.Living Room Sketch
Interior design is all about creating a cohesive and visually appealing space. When drawing your living room, keep in mind the overall design style you want to achieve. Bold and modern? Cozy and rustic? Make sure your drawing reflects your desired interior design style to ensure a cohesive look.Living Room Interior Design
The layout of your living room is crucial to its functionality and flow. As you draw out your living room, consider the placement of key elements such as the TV, seating area, and windows. Italicize any details that are unique to your space, such as a fireplace or built-in shelving.Living Room Layout
No living room is complete without decor! From wall art to throw pillows, these finishing touches can really bring your living room to life. Make sure to include any decorative elements in your drawing and pay attention to their placement and size.Living Room Decor
A perspective drawing is a great way to get a realistic view of your living room design. By drawing the room from an angle, you can better visualize how everything will look once it's all put together. Use perspective lines to create depth and dimension in your drawing.Living Room Perspective Drawing
The arrangement of your furniture is just as important as the furniture itself. When drawing your living room, play around with different furniture layouts to see what works best. Consider traffic flow and conversation areas when deciding on a furniture arrangement.Living Room Furniture Arrangement
A floor plan is a top-down view of your living room and is essential for planning out the space. This will help you determine the size and placement of furniture and other elements. Include a floor plan in your living room drawing to ensure accuracy and efficiency in the design process.Living Room Floor Plan
When drawing your living room, don't be afraid to get creative and try out different design ideas. This is your chance to experiment with different styles, colors, and layouts to find the perfect fit for your space. Use your drawing as a blueprint for bringing your design ideas to life in your actual living room.
